About Beth
I take piano seriously, but I have also experienced how fun and playful and beautiful it is, which means that at the end of the day I hope learning with me helps you become a disciplined, skilled, but also eager piano player who enjoys playing the instrument. It is hard work, and takes commitment (especially at first), but it is very worth it, even if you decide not to keep up with it longterm. I am also an older sister (I have three younger siblings) who likes to laugh, which means I'm used to balancing an orderly, by-the-book attitude with an attitude that also makes things cheerful and chill, and I hope that shows if we take lessons together. I was taught to play the piano through a classical method, from which I've taken different pros and cons. As someone who once took lessons, I think that every piano player should:
- spend more time on the keys than they do in a theory book (though theory has its place)
- be able to sight read well
- know the flats and sharps of every key (by knowing the respective scales)
- dabble thoroughly (at least in the beginning) in the different styles (including classical and jazz) for two purposes:
a) to be well-versed
b) to find what they love
- have a passion project that they are committed to learning, regardless of its level of difficulty
- know the rules well enough to bend them (improvising is fun!)
My level of experience and teaching style are primarily geared towards people who are just starting out at the beginner level, and I will work with anyone at this level regardless of how old they are!
My lessons are shaped according to the list above, and will include an opening exercise of scale practice, we will go over any theory related work (which will depend on how much theory work the individual needs), practice a song that has been picked from one of the mainstream genres to learn, and end with either practicing a song the individual has chosen for themselves or with some improvising to end the lesson on a more playful, loosened up note.
